How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kentwood?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Kentwood Studio Apartments | $575 | $575 | $575 |
| Kentw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,217 | $625 | $1,909 |
| Kentw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,299 | $700 | $2,121 |
| Kentw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,513 | $905 | $2,167 |
| Kentwood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$995 | $995 | $995 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Kentwood
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Kentwood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Kentwood ranges from $625 to $1,909 with an average monthly rent of $1,217.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Kentwood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Kentwood range from $700 to $2,121.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,299.
How expensive are Kentwood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 25 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Kentwood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$905 to $2,167 - averaging $1,513 for the location.
